The company sent the wrong order and it was returned. However, they did not refund the cost or replace the order with the correct product. Then they cancelled my membership. The cancellation was fine with me since I was going to cancel it myself. The Detox teas worked fine for a while and then it just became tea. The powdered Collagen product was too sweet and the flavoring wasn't very good. When you use an artificial sweetener you use about half of what you would use if you used sugar.

Never received August package that they tell me was delivered...
Very disappointed with this companies customer service. I had 2 months auto deliveries no problem. The 3rd month they charged me on the 1st of August never sent package out until I contacted them asking what my tracking number was on the 13th of August. It was sent out and they say it was delivered but I have yet to receive it on the 3rd of September. Now they have charged me for my September 1st order to which I sent requesting my tracking number already because I do not want another month that my order does not show up!! Depending on how the rectify my issue with missing August order and my September tracking number I will be canceling any future orders with them.
